Obituary for Donald McLemore

Donald Ray McLemore passed away on October 26, 2019 at his home in Mill A, Washington surrounded by family. Don was born on October 18, 1936 and was 83 years of age at the time of his passing.

Don was born at Duncan, Oklahoma to Haskell and Edith Elizabeth (Smith) McLemore. He celebrated 63 years of marriage to Bessie Ann Hamilton on June 16th. Don was a devoted husband, father, grandfather and great grandfather.

He was a hardworking heavy equipment operator, a welder at the Bonneville Dam, a Skamania County Reserve Sheriff’s Deputy and EMT and a millwright for WKO, Inc. He also worked odd jobs long after his “official” retirement. He enjoyed fishing, hunting, trips to the beach, his pets but most of all time with his family. He will be remembered for his smile and happiness, his famous funny quick-wit sayings, his positive attitude and big heart. He will be deeply missed by his friends, family and all who knew him.

Don is survived by his wife, Bessie; son, Darin (and wife, Tina) McLemore; daughter, Terri and her wife Yamiska; his beloved grandchildren and great grandchildren. He was preceded in death by his daughter, Dottie and sister, Barbara.
